In 2023, the production value for gutted fresh European hake in France stood at an estimated €34.37 million. From 2024 to 2028, projections indicate steady growth, with the production value rising from €34.37 million to €36.44 million. This reflects consistent year-on-year increases with a 1.53% increase in 2025, 1.49% in 2026, 1.45% in 2027, and ending with a 1.42% rise in 2028. The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) for the 2024-2028 period is forecasted at approximately 1.5%.
